Basic but OK
Pros:

You cannot expect a 5* service in a budget hotel... and this applies also to Hotel Weber. But some of the reviews here are clearly outdated or biased. To put it simply: it‘s a budget hotel, rooms are basic but clean, and for 1-2 nights it‘s not bad. Location is great: just a few minutes from the train station and 10 min. to the old part of town. The tram stop is not too distant either. My room had a proper private bathroom with shower, mirror etc., it was clean, no complaints there. The bed was not top, the mattress low quality and the bedcover could be changed, but all in all not uncomfortable. Not much space for luggage, though. A small TV (French channels only) and free WiFi (good for surfing but not for streaming), that should also be improved! My room in the back was very quiet, no noise from the street, but the acoustic isolation between the rooms is thin.
Again, don‘t expect anything fancy, and rooms may differ in threir outfit and price.... (check on that!) Certainly the owners should invest a little bit to make the place look more welcoming, but most likely they don’t care, money is coming in anyway. This city is reknown for its rip-off hotel rates and bad value for money at all accomodation levels: but if you‘re on a budget and come by train for a stopover visit to Strasbourg, it‘s OK.
